What Each Section Does
OSC (Oscillator) 
This section generates an audio waveform according to the pitch 
information that is sent from the keyboard. The pitch is determined by 
how rapidly the waveform repeats. Faster repetition (higher frequency) 
means higher pitch, and slower repetition (lower frequency) means 
lower pitch.
By applying an LFO to the OSC section, you can cyclically raise and 
lower the pitch, producing a vibrato eect.

FILTER
Although the oscillator generates a sound at a specic frequency, this 
sound contains numerous harmonics.
The lter lets you modify the brightness of the sound by selectively 
reducing these harmonics or boosting them in the region of the cuto 
frequency.
By applying an LFO to the FILTER section, you can cyclically raise or 
lower the cuto frequency, producing a wah eect.

KEY FOLLOW
Varies the lter’s cuto frequency according to the position of 
the key.
Higher values of this setting cause the cuto frequency to 
increase as you play higher on the keyboard, and lower values 
cause the cuto frequency to decrease as you play higher.

LFO (Low Frequency Oscillator) 
Like the OSC section, the LFO section generates a waveform at a 
specied frequency. The shape of this waveform controls the section 
to which the LFO is applied.

ENVELOPE
Each time you press a key, a time-based change is applied to the OSC, 
FILTER, and AMP sections for each individual note.
This shape of this time-based change is called the “envelope.”
